Output 99385c1163b5004ae29304fed02e1d28f1158a683451b1c05d1811ca1c46d780:0

value
43240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fea7f68e5abf5b498b175604ad9233319def54f1 OP_EQUAL
address
3QuWmYruEcb4kaGPSZJ8c4uoR11WY9CCGK
transaction
99385c1163b5004ae29304fed02e1d28f1158a683451b1c05d1811ca1c46d780
spent
true